Software Engineer
Position Overview
The Software Engineer designs, develops, troubleshoots, and debugs software programs for enhancements and new products. They will also develop software and tools in support of design, infrastructure, and technology platforms. This role is for a seasoned, experienced professional with a full understanding of their specialty, capable of resolving a wide range of issues in creative ways. The individual will work on problems of a diverse scope and receive little instruction on day-to-day work, with general instruction on new assignments.
